Output 8acf2ff9266f65a2b3e0d280a892987bfba598c214a524d031220b76f0e52057:18

value
1650919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a1660cb2acac32b8a28d0c342d4e866e8283106 OP_EQUAL
address
344xJPWqfBNAgtGh58FhL23L8Sy78sxEWt
transaction
8acf2ff9266f65a2b3e0d280a892987bfba598c214a524d031220b76f0e52057
spent
true